Craigslist queen that was not a prank or in Nowhere USA, a 64 F100 long wide bed find with almost perfect body. She was bought by a Ford nut for a donor body on 80's frame swap that never happened. I dealt for her and am in the process of research and getting her to the first vehicles 3 S's Starting, Steering and Stopping . She has a Mercedes Benz OM314 4 cylinder diesel engine with a 4 speed tranny. The engine was 85-100 hp and built between 1964 and 1980. The truck has worn many colors, originally Turquoise, then State Road (safety) yellow, with a pealing White top coat with Blue rust prevention dabbing. I plan to keep the MB diesel in place if runnable , or repower with a 6 cylinder I have in a donor frame. I plan to kill the rust and seal the shade tree patina less the green pond scum. The body is solid except for two fifty cent piece sized holes in one fender and the tailgate hinge end. This is real rare for a West Virginia truck as they salt the crap out of the roads here in winter. I plan a low budget retro rat rod with no body mods. Let the fun begin. Yep, cover the basics. Sounds like you have plenty to clean up and test. That old of a diesel should be mechanically injected. Probably Bosch, VE or P pump if you're lucky, both of which are well documented on how to set up. Easy to turn up the power, once you've got the basics sorted out.

Thanks for the reply. The MB engine has a mechanical injector pump with no blower. I hope it is ok because the swap is unusual to say the least and people would get a kick out of it. The engine was used in ton trucks and small buses, so it should power an empty classic truck. Remember flathead V-8 were 100hp when new. Project update: We pull started the OM314 4 cylinder engine , it fired up within 15 feet with no smoke and no bad rattles. We have to get juice from the batteries to the starter as the series/parallel switch just buzzes . The engine at 1200 rpm held 100psi oil pressure, with 50 psi at 700 rpm with old oil. There is hope for the diesel F100. I am still having picture troubles posting.

Progress since last post....GM steering wheel in truck was stock length and too long for Ford stuck too far into the cab towards the seat. I am going to put in a 1985 Firebird tilt in instead . The MB diesel has a 24 volt starter but I have found a 12 volt model instead. Truck at a friend's house 2 counties away so visits are few and far between . New wheel cylinders will make the stopping possible. I like the 3 's Starting, Steering and Stopping!!!!
